JKRA felicitates Aneesha ahead of ISSF Junior World Championship 2026
6/12/2026 9:38:31 PM
Early Times Report
JAMMU, June 12: In a proud moment for the shooting fraternity of Jammu & Kashmir, talented young shooter Aneesha has been selected to represent India in the 10m Air Rifle event at the prestigious ISSF Junior World Championship 2026, scheduled to be held from June 16 to June 26, 2026, at the Shooting Center Suhl (SSZ), Suhl, Germany. The championship, regarded as the biggest global youth shooting event of the year, will witness the participation of over 800 young athletes from approximately 66 countries, making it one of the most competitive international shooting events for junior shooters from across the world.
During a special interaction at the KSS Training Camp, New Delhi, Sh. S. S. Sodhi, Governing Body Member of the National Rifle Association of India (NRAI), President of the Jammu & Kashmir Rifle Association (JKRA), and Chairman of the NRAI Souvenir & Badges Committee, felicitated Aneesha and extended financial assistance and best wishes on behalf of JKRA and NRAI as she prepares to represent the country at this prestigious international championship.
Extending his heartfelt congratulations and best wishes, Sh. Sodhi lauded Aneesha's dedication, perseverance, and remarkable achievement in earning a place in the Indian contingent for the world championship. He stated that her selection is a matter of immense pride for Jammu & Kashmir and serves as an inspiration for aspiring shooters across the region.
Wishing her success in the championship, Sh. Sodhi said, "Representing India at the ISSF Junior World Championship is a significant achievement. We are proud of Aneesha's accomplishment and confident that she will perform with determination and excellence on the world stage. We hope she brings glory to Jammu & Kashmir and India through her outstanding performance."
Dilbag Singh (IPS Retd.), Former Director General of Police and Chief Patron of JKRA, also conveyed his heartfelt blessings and best wishes to Aneesha and expressed confidence that she would excel while representing the nation at the highest level of junior shooting.
The entire leadership and shooting fraternity of the Jammu & Kashmir Rifle Association joined in extending their best wishes. These included Chairman Kuldeep Singh Jamwal, CEO Sharat Chander, Treasurer Mansotra, Technical Chairman Rajesh Virdi, all District Presidents, Vice Presidents, Executive Members, coaches, and fellow shooters from across Jammu & Kashmir.
Members of the Mission Olympic Shooting Range, along with her coaches Mr. Vishal Mehra and Mr. Aman, also conveyed their good wishes and prayers for her success. Her teammates and the entire shooting community expressed confidence in her talent, discipline, and hard work and prayed for a memorable performance that brings laurels to Jammu & Kashmir and India.
